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A battery electrode assembly includes a current collector with conduction barrier regions having a conductive state in which electrical conductivity through the conduction barrier region is permitted, and a safety state in which electrical conductivity through the conduction barrier regions is reduced. The conduction barrier regions change from the conductive state to the safety state when the current collector receives a short-threatening event. An electrode material can be connected to the current collector. The conduction barrier regions can define electrical isolation subregions. A battery is also disclosed, and methods for making the electrode assembly, methods for making a battery, and methods for operating a battery.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

We claim: 1. A method of making an electrode, comprising the step of forming in a current collector a plurality of electrical isolation subregions defined at least in part by conduction barrier regions formed in the current collector, the isolation subregions having a conductive state in which the isolation subregions are not electrically isolated from other isolation subregions, and a safety state in which at least one isolation subregion is electrically isolated from at least one adjacent isolation subregion such that electrical conductivity through the adjacent isolation subregions in the safety state is reduced. 2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ising the step of making a battery with the electrode. 3. A method of operating a battery, comprising the steps of: forming the battery with at least one current collector comprising conduction barrier regions having a conductive state in which electrical conductivity through the conduction barrier region is permitted, and a safety state in which electrical conductivity through the conduction barrier regions is reduced, the conduction barrier regions changing from the conductive state to the safety state when the current collector receives a short-threatening event; and an electrode material connected to the current collector; experiencing a short-threatening event at a conduction barrier region of the at least one current collector, whereupon the conduction barrier region will change from the conductive state to the safety state; and, operating the battery with the at least one conduction barrier region in the safety state and at least one other conduction barrier region in the conductive state.
